Summer Math Research Assistant information

What is a summer math research assistant?

A Summer Math Research Assistant is typically a student or early-career researcher who supports mathematics faculty or research teams during the summer. Their responsibilities may include gathering data, running simulations, analyzing mathematical models, and assisting with academic papers or presentations. This role provides hands-on experience in mathematical research and often helps students develop skills relevant to graduate school or STEM careers. Summer Math Research Assistants may work at universities, research institutes, or through special summer programs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a summer math research ass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Summer Math Research Assistant, you need strong mathematical reasoning, problem-solving skills, and familiarity with advanced math concepts, often supported by coursework in mathematics or related fields. Proficiency in mathematical software such as MATLAB, Mathematica, or Python is typically required, along with experience using research databases and tools. Attention to detail, effective communication, and collaborative teamwork are essential soft skills in this role. These abilities ensure high-quality research contributions, facilitate clear presentation of findings, and foster productive collaboration within research teams.

What are the most common challenges faced by summer math research assistants, and how can they be addressed?

Summer Math Research Assistants often encounter challenges such as adapting to new mathematical concepts quickly, managing multiple research tasks, and collaborating with diverse team members. To address these, it's important to communicate regularly with your supervisor and peers, stay organized with project timelines, and proactively seek clarification when needed. Engaging in group discussions and attending lab meetings can also help you stay connected and informed, making the research experience more rewarding and less overwhelming.

Johnson & Johnson MedTech is recruiting multiple candidates for our Research & Development summer internship located in Jacksonville, FL.

Research, innovation, and new product development is our focus.

With a powerful mission to change the trajectory of eye health, our Vision organization is committed to understanding the challenges impacting patients and apply deep science and engineering to enable innovative solutions. We provide our patients with a new horizon through our ACUVUE® family of contact lenses and our wide portfolio of intraocular lenses (IOL) and vision surgery technology.

Summer interns will partner with teams of scientists and engineers to expand our deep technical capabilities and develop new products aimed at meeting a variety of eye health needs.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Execute a project assignment involving an eye health product (spanning early research to pilot/commercialization stage), an enabling technology, or our internal operations that enable research and development.
  • Perform deliverables involving fundamental research and characterization, process/product development, clinical study execution, regulatory submissions, test method development, and/or equipment development.
  • Work closely with other technical disciplines in the development and application of equipment and processes.
  • Act as an advocate for continuous improvement of internal processes and enabling technology.
  • Review progress and evaluates results of project(s) across various functional groups.

Qualifications

Education:

  • Current student in a four-year degree program (Engineering, Materials Science, Chemistry, Biochemistry, Biology, Health Science, or equivalent).

Experience and Skills:

Required:

  • Availability to relocate to the Jacksonville area for the summer internship.

Preferred:

  • Experience in a relevant field (i.e. internship, research assistant, and/or coursework).
  • Prior work experience.

Candidate Eligibility

candidates must:

  • Be authorized to work in the U.S. without sponsorship now or in the future.
  • Remain enrolled in their academic program throughout the Co-op period.
  • Be available to work full-time during the assignment (40 hours per week)
  • Have a minimum GPA of 3.0.
